BANs of differentially expressed genes in common between cell lines. The lists of common genes between both colon cancer cell lines, between both breast cancer cell lines, and among the other three cell lines studied (representative of pancreatic cancer, leukemia and osteosarcoma) were used to construct BANs with the Pathway Architect software. Expanded networks were constructed for each list - (a) colon cancer, (b) breast cancer and (c) the other three cell lines - by setting an advanced filter that included the categories of binding, expression, metabolism, promoter binding, protein modification and regulation (see legend). Only proteins are represented. Overlapping of the expression levels was also performed (red for overexpressed genes and green for underexpressed genes; translucent shading represents genes that were not in the list and were added by the program from the interactions database). The BANs show some node genes that were studied further (those with arrows pointing to them).
